Book Description

Secondhand. Good condition. Some general edgewear.

Each week from the 1850s to the 1940s, thousands of Australians would change from their civilian clothes into military uniform in the evening or on the weekends to practise military drills and target shooting.

Craig Wilcox's first book. Now hard to find.
